Katie gives Maggie half of her pencils. Maggie keeps 5 and gives the rest to jamil. Write an expression for the number of pencil

s Maggie gives to jamil

Answer

Write an expression for the number of pencils Maggie gives to jamil.

To prove

Let us assume that the number of pencils Katie have = x

As given

Katie gives Maggie half of her pencils.

Katie\ gives\ Maggie\ half\ of\ her\ pencils = \frac{1x}{2}

As given

Maggie keeps 5 and gives the rest to jamil.

Thus

Number\ of\ pencils\ Maggie\ gives\ to\ jamil = \frac{1x}{2} - 5

Therefore the expression for the number of pencils Maggie gives to jamil are  \frac{1x}{2} - 5.
